Output 09abae150ec23211656ccf42cd1ab3cb441d451f3186fa48e48a49a4e3931169: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46b3334bdcf57de85749a3df052279d546dcd0a1 OP_EQUALVERIFY OP_CHECKSIG
address
PeNc7a2ePJnZVbU8WAeMQSZA6P73fvxKW7
transaction
09abae150ec23211656ccf42cd1ab3cb441d451f3186fa48e48a49a4e3931169